Baseball field upgrades debut at Tuscora Park – with turfing planned next

NEW PHILADELPHIA (WJER) (March 31, 2026) – Highly anticipated upgrades to Baseball Field Number One at Tuscora Park have been earning rave reviews after debuting over the weekend.

The non-profit Baseball Now and Forever group spearheaded the work – all made possible by financial, labor, and material donations from the community members and contractors.

Group member Kelly Ricklic says those Phase One improvements include a new scoreboard, a vinyl‑coated chain‑link fence surrounding the field, ADA‑compliant bleachers, and new dugouts.

Ricklic and committee members first started showing off plans to fully renovate the baseball field nearly four years ago.

The group is now raising funds for Phase Two, which would fully turf the field. An online auction featuring major and minor league baseball items was happening Saturday, and organizers say they’re about a quarter of the way toward their $400,000 goal.

Saturday’s festivities also included an emotional pre‑game ceremony, announcing the stadium will now honor longtime athletics supporter Tom Farbizo, with the field named for former Quaker baseball coach Jim Watson.

New Philadelphia won that home opener Saturday, 9‑to‑3, over John Glenn.
